Cargill is a manufacturing company focusing on food, agricultural, financial, and industrial products and services. Founded in 1865, this privately-held international firm operates in 67 countries with a workforce of 142,000 people. Collaboration and innovation are central to Cargill's approach, leveraging its research and development capabilities to generate value through new products, improved processes, and cost-reduction strategies. With a global team of over 1,300 specialists in various fields, the company provides technical services, applications development, research, intellectual asset management, and scientific and regulatory affairs.

Diverse demographics characterize Cargill's staff, including 36.5% female representation and 35.8% ethnic minorities among employees. Employee satisfaction remains high within the company, as evidenced by an average retention rate of 5.1 years. Despite lower wages compared to some competitors, Cargill continues to excel as an industry leader with 166,000 employees and an annual revenue of $114.7 billion. Headquartered in Minnesota, the company is committed to addressing economic, environmental, and social challenges by sharing its global knowledge and experience.

Cargill salaries

The average a Cargill salary in the United States is $48,511 per year. Cargill employees in the top 10 percent can make over $94,000 per year, while Cargill employees at the bottom 10 percent earn less than $24,000 per year.

  • Cargill has 166,000 employees.
  • 37% of Cargill employees are women, while 63% are men.
  • The most common ethnicity at Cargill is White (64%).
  • 16% of Cargill employees are Hispanic or Latino.
  • 9% of Cargill employees are Black or African American.
  • The average employee at Cargill makes $48,511 per year.
  • Cargill employees are most likely to be members of the democratic party.
  • Employees at Cargill stay with the company for 5.1 years on average.
